Heim  >  Artikel  >  Welches Protokoll verwendet der Befehl „ping“?

Welches Protokoll verwendet der Befehl „ping“?

Guanhui
GuanhuiOriginal
2020-07-24 16:27:5131656Durchsuche

Welches Protokoll verwendet der Befehl „ping“?

Welches Protokoll verwendet der „Ping“-Befehl?

Der Befehl „ping“ verwendet das ICMP-Protokoll, das ein Unterprotokoll der TCP/IP-Protokollsuite ist und zur Übertragung von Steuernachrichten zwischen IP-Hosts und Routern verwendet wird ob das Netzwerk verbunden ist oder nicht, ob der Host erreichbar ist, ob die Route verfügbar ist und andere Informationen über das Netzwerk selbst.

ICMP-Protokoll

Das ICMP-Protokoll ist ein verbindungsloses Protokoll, das zur Übertragung von Fehlerberichtskontrollinformationen verwendet wird. Es ist ein sehr wichtiges Protokoll und äußerst wichtig für die Netzwerksicherheit. Es handelt sich um ein Netzwerkschichtprotokoll, das hauptsächlich zum Übertragen von Steuerinformationen zwischen Hosts und Routern verwendet wird, einschließlich der Meldung von Fehlern, dem Austausch eingeschränkter Steuer- und Statusinformationen usw. Wenn IP-Daten nicht auf das Ziel zugreifen können oder der IP-Router Datenpakete nicht mit der aktuellen Übertragungsrate weiterleiten kann, werden automatisch ICMP-Nachrichten gesendet.

ICMP ist ein wichtiges Mitglied der Netzwerkschicht im TCP/IP-Modell. Zusammen mit dem IP-Protokoll, dem ARP-Protokoll, dem RARP-Protokoll und dem IGMP-Protokoll bildet es die Netzwerkschicht im TCP/IP-Modell. Ping und Tracert sind zwei häufig verwendete Netzwerkverwaltungsbefehle. Ping wird zum Testen der Netzwerkerreichbarkeit verwendet, und Tracert wird zum Anzeigen des Pfads zum Zielhost verwendet. Sowohl Ping als auch Tracert verwenden das ICMP-Protokoll zur Implementierung von Netzwerkfunktionen. Sie sind typische Beispiele für die Anwendung von Netzwerkprotokollen bei der täglichen Netzwerkverwaltung.

Aus technischer Sicht ist ICMP ein „Fehlererkennungs- und Meldemechanismus“, dessen Zweck es uns ermöglicht, den Netzwerkverbindungsstatus zu erkennen und die Genauigkeit der Verbindung sicherzustellen. Wenn ein Unfall auftritt, während der Router ein Datenpaket verarbeitet, kann er das entsprechende Ereignis über ICMP an die Quelle des Datenpakets melden.

Seine Hauptfunktionen sind: Erkennen der Existenz von Remote-Hosts, Erstellen und Verwalten von Routing-Daten, Umleiten von Datenübertragungspfaden (ICMP-Umleitung) und Datenflusskontrolle. Während der Kommunikation verwendet ICMP hauptsächlich verschiedene Kategorien (Typ) und Codes (Code), damit Maschinen unterschiedliche Verbindungsbedingungen identifizieren können.

ICMP ist ein sehr nützliches Protokoll, insbesondere wenn wir den Netzwerkverbindungsstatus beurteilen müssen.

Empfohlenes Tutorial „PHP

Das obige ist der detaillierte Inhalt vonWelches Protokoll verwendet der Befehl „ping“?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n